Bruce Hornsby, known for his unique blend of bluegrass and contemporary influences, delivers a captivating experience with his 1995 album "Hot House." Released under RCA Records, this 59-minute journey through 11 tracks showcases Hornsby's exceptional musicianship and storytelling prowess. From the lively "Spider Fingers" to the soulful "The Longest Night," each song is a testament to Hornsby's ability to weave intricate melodies with heartfelt lyrics. The album's standout tracks, like "White Wheeled Limousine" and "The Tango King," highlight his versatility and knack for creating memorable tunes.
